Position Description:
The Walker Department of Mechanical Engineering at The University of Texas at Austin seeks applicants for multiple tenure-track positions. Although candidates at the rank of Assistant Professor are preferred, applications from senior candidates will also be considered for the Advanced Manufacturing search. Candidates with expertise in the following research areas are of the most interest to the Department. (Candidates should view these areas of emphasis in the broadest sense in determining whether they match their research skills and interests.)

  • NUCLEAR ENGINEERING, with an emphasis on nuclear materials and nuclear robotics.
  • THERMAL-FLUID SCIENCE & ENGINEERING. Two positions are available in the following areas:
    1. Fluid mechanics and thermal sciences, with applications to electrical, optical, thermal, and mechanical components for information, energy, and biomedical technologies.
    2. Experimental thermal-fluid science and engineering with particular interest in applications for power and propulsion systems.
  • ADVANCED MANUFACTURING, with an emphasis on systems and processes including (but not limited to) smart manufacturing, multi-material manufacturing, and multi-scale manufacturing for functional devices.

Qualifications:
Candidates must have completed a Ph.D. degree in Engineering or a related field prior to their start date. Successful candidates will be expected to:

  • Create undergraduate and graduate learning environments that address the needs of students from a variety of backgrounds, with differing learning approaches and abilities.
  • Develop an externally sponsored research program.
  • Mentor graduate students.
  • Collaborate with other faculty.
  • Be involved in service to the university and the profession.

The Walker Department of Mechanical Engineering is committed to supporting the success of all members of our community: students, staff, and faculty. A successful candidate can expect to benefit from and contribute to those efforts.
